Define Your Event Goals
Before diving into details, identify the purpose of your event. Is it to celebrate, promote, or connect? Clear goals help shape decisions around theme, venue, and overall experience.
Budget Planning and Allocation
A well-planned budget is the backbone of any successful event. Break down your expenses into categories such as venue, catering, décor, entertainment, and photography. Always keep a buffer for unexpected costs.
Choosing the Right Venue
The venue sets the tone for your event. Consider factors like location, capacity, accessibility, and ambiance. A perfect venue enhances the overall guest experience.
Designing the Theme and Décor
Your event’s theme reflects its personality. From elegant weddings to vibrant themed parties, cohesive décor creates a visually stunning atmosphere that guests will remember.
Selecting Reliable Vendors
Collaborating with experienced vendors ensures smooth execution. Choose professionals for catering, photography, entertainment, and logistics who align with your vision.
Managing Time and Schedule
Create a detailed timeline covering every stage of the event. This helps avoid last-minute stress and ensures everything happens on time.
Preparing for the Unexpected
No matter how well you plan, challenges can arise. Having backup plans for weather, technical issues, or delays ensures your event stays on track.
